Randomized trial of vitamin D supplementation to prevent seasonal influenza A in schoolchildren
Influenza A occurred in 18 of 167 (10.8%) children in the vitamin D3 group compared with 31 of 167 (18.6%) children in the placebo group. The reduction in influenza A was more prominent in children who had not been taking other vitamin D supplements and who started nursery school after age 3 y. In children with a previous diagnosis of asthma, asthma attacks as a secondary outcome occurred in 2 children receiving vitamin D3 compared with 12 children receiving placebo.

The study suggests that vitamin D3 supplementation during the winter may reduce the incidence of influenza A, especially in specific subgroups of schoolchildren.

Use of medication for insomnia or anxiety increases mortality risk by 36 percent
Taking medications to treat insomnia and anxiety increases mortality risk by 36%, according to a study conducted by Geneviève Belleville, a professor at Université Laval’s School of Psychology. The details of this study are published in the latest edition of the Canadian Journal of Psychiatry.

Dr. Belleville arrived at these results through analysis of 12 years of data on over 14,000 Canadians in Statistics Canada’s National Population Health Survey.


Osteoporosis drugs linked to oesophageal cancer and jaw tissue death
A new study just published in the British Medical Journal (BMJ) has found that there is increased risk of oesophageal (gullet) cancer with one or more previous prescriptions for the commonly prescribed osteoporosis drugs, bisphosphonates.

Wyeth paid ghostwriters to promote hormone therapy
Dr. Adriane Fugh-Berman of Georgetown University Medical Center in Washington and colleagues analyzed dozens of ghostwritten reviews and commentaries published in medical journals and journal supplements, many of them using documents from judicial trials.

They said Wyeth, now owned by Pfizer, paid a medical communication company called DesignWrite $25,000 to ghostwrite articles on clinical studies, including four testing low-dose Prempro, the company's combination estrogen-progestin therapy.


Would-be blockbuster vaccine Gardasil causes Merck financial headaches
Four years after Merck (MRK, Fortune 500) released this would-be top-seller, called Gardasil, it has proven to be a marketplace dud. In Merck's second quarter, the company reported an 18% year-over-year drop in sales to $219 million and its stock is down nearly 3% to date. Analysts are pointing to the Gardasil vaccine not as a savior, but as a risk for investors. People are spending less on medicine in general. Some parents aren't comfortable vaccinating young children against a virus they can only get from having sex. Merck didn't properly prepare the right doctors. Merck couldn't counter the bad press.


Flu vaccine does not reduce risk of severe complications
Italian researchers found that influenza vaccine did not reduce risk of severe complications from influenza viral infection such as in-hospital death, influenza or pneumonia admission in elderly people.

The finding came after Manzoli L. and colleagues from the University G. d'Annunzio of Chieti in Italy examined data from 32,457 elderly people of whom 66.2 percent received influenza vaccine.


Cochrane Review: Studies Fail To Demonstrate Safety Or Effectiveness Of Influenza Vaccine In Children And Adults
An independent analysis by the internationally renowned Cochrane Collaboration of worldwide influenza vaccine studies, published in the British Medical Journal on Oct. 28, concluded there is little scientific proof that inactivated influenza vaccine is safe and effective for children and adults. Citing the Cochrane Collaboration finding as well as methodological flaws in a child influenza vaccine study published Oct. 25 in the Journal of the American Medical Association (JAMA), the National Vaccine Information Center is calling on the Centers for Disease Control (CDC) to stop recommending annual flu shots for all infants and children until methodologically sound studies are conducted.

"There is a big gap between policies promoting annual influenza vaccinations for most children and adults and supporting scientific evidence," said epidemiologist Tom Jefferson, Cochrane Vaccines Field, Rome, Italy, who coordinated the comprehensive analysis for the prestigious Cochrane Collaboration. "Given the significant resources involved in annual mass influenza campaigns, there is urgent need for re-evaluation of these strategies."
